Nuclear energy involves potential energy stored in the nucleus of an atom, which is released as kinetic energy when atoms split or fuse in a nuclear reaction.

The energy involved in a mole of unstable uranium primarily comes from nuclear potential energy due to the strong nuclear forces within its atomic nucleus. When uranium undergoes radioactive decay or fission, this potential energy is released in the form of kinetic energy, gamma radiation, and other particles. This process contributes to the overall energy output in nuclear reactions, making uranium a significant source of nuclear energy.
